Forbes Briefly Puts Elon Musk at $500 Billion, a First for Any Individual

The fleeting peak reflects Tesla’s latest share surge, with net-worth estimates varying widely by methodology.

Overview

  • Musk’s fortune touched about $500.1 billion before easing to roughly $499.1 billion on Wednesday, according to Forbes’ real-time tracker.
  • Tesla’s stock rose nearly 4% on the day and is up more than 14% this year, adding roughly $7 billion to his paper wealth, with SpaceX and xAI valuations also contributing.
  • Other gauges place him lower, with Bloomberg’s billionaires index around $459 billion, underscoring differences in how equity stakes and private valuations are tallied.
  • Tesla’s board has floated a compensation plan valued at up to $1 trillion contingent on ambitious milestones, with shareholder decisions and ongoing court reviews still pending.
